Special Needs Resource Base (SNRB) Teacher

Location: Torfaen.
Start date:
September 2024.
Contract type:
Temp to perm school contract.

A super exciting opportunity has arisen in the Torfaen area for a Teacher to work within the Special Needs Resource Base within a secondary school. The school are seeking a teacher that is dedicated, passionate and able to provide a fresh perspective within the department. This role would be suitable for a primary or secondary trained teacher (mainstream or SNRB experience).

About the role:

  • Assisting pupils with complex learning difficulties.
  • Experience with speech and language, Autism and behavioural needs desirable.
  • Full-time Monday to Friday 08:30am-15:00pm.
  • Working alongside a Leader, 2 other Teachers and a Higher Level Teaching Assistant and a team of 6 Teaching Assistants.
  • School are open to Newly Qualified Teachers (NQT).

About you:

  • Passionate, caring and approachable.
  • Fully qualified teacher (primary or secondary trained).
  • Able to work with pupils with learning difficulties.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• An understanding of Autism and behavioural needs.
  • Extremely patient and able to act on initiative.

This is a fantastic role and a rare chance to join a department where you are truly supported. You will play a significant role in helping the pupils reach their potential and enjoy their school life. The pupils have a range of needs that include Autism, speech and language difficulties and complex learning difficulties. You will play a vital part in these pupils lives for both their wellbeing and assisting with their life skills and school work.
